How Our Bathroom Water Removal Process Works

When you call us for Bathroom Water Removal, you can expect a seamless process that gets your home back to normal as quickly as possible.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that every step is taken care of, from initial assessment to final restoration.

Initial Assessment

Our expert technician will arrive at your doorstep within 60 minutes to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. We’ll identify the source of the leak, evaluate the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an for restoration.

Water Extraction

Using state-of-the-art equipment, our technician will extract as much water as possible from the affected area. We’ll work quickly to reduce further damage and prevent secondary flooding.

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ry the area and remove any remaining moisture. This step is crucial to preventing mold growth and further damage.

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We’ll thoroughly sanitize and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This step is essential to ensuring your home is safe and healthy for you and your family.

Final Inspection and Restoration

Once the drying and sanitizing process is complete, our technician will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your home is safe and sound. We’ll make any necessary repairs and provide you with a comprehensive report of the work completed.

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Removal

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Noticeable water stains on your ceiling or walls are a clear indication of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s down the line.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ant musty smells in your home can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Cracks in the Walls or Floor

Visible cracks in your walls or floor can show structural damage or uneven settling. These sign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ards.

Water Pooling on the Floor

Water pooling on your floor is a clear indication of a leak or water damage. Don’t wait, contact us today to get started on your Bathroom Water Removal job.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ew in your home can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s and even health risks.

Higher Than Normal Water Bills

Noticeable increases in your water bills can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s down the line.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ost in Amelia City, FL

The cost of Bathroom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Amelia City, FL.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$1,500 Size of the affected area, type of equipment required
Sanitizing and disinfecting $200 – $500 Type of surfaces affected, severity of mold or mildew growth
Final inspection and restoration $500 – $1,000 Complexity of the restoration process, number of repairs required
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$300 Time of day, complexity of the damage
More services (e.g. Repair of damaged drywall or flooring) $500 – $2,500 Scope of the project, type of materials required
